Deprecate/block packets with a missing/invalid hop_start value (pre-hop firmware) (related to issue #7369) (#9476)

* Deprecate forwarding for invalid hop_start

* Add pre-hop packet drop policy

* Log ignored rebroadcasts for pre-hop packets

* Respect pre-hop policy ALLOW in routing gates

* Exempt local packets from pre-hop drop policy

* Format pre-hop log line

* Add MODERN_ONLY rebroadcast mode for pre-hop packets

* Simplify implementation for drop packet only behaviour

* Revert formatting-only changes

* Match ReliableRouter EOF formatting

* Make pre-hop drop a build-time flag

* Rework to compile/build flag MESHTASTIC_PREHOP_DROP

* Set MESHTASTIC_PREHOP_DROP off by default

* Inline pre-hop hop_start validity check

HopStartStatus classifyHopStart(const meshtastic_MeshPacket &p)
{
// Guard against invalid values.
if (p.hop_start < p.hop_limit)
return HopStartStatus::INVALID;
if (p.hop_start == 0) {
// Firmware prior to 2.3.0 (585805c) lacked a hop_start field. Firmware version 2.5.0 (bf34329) introduced a
// bitfield that is always present. Use the presence of the bitfield to determine if the origin's firmware
// version is guaranteed to have hop_start populated. Note that this can only be done for decoded packets as
// the bitfield is encrypted under the channel encryption key.
if (p.which_payload_variant == meshtastic_MeshPacket_decoded_tag && p.decoded.has_bitfield)
return HopStartStatus::VALID;
return HopStartStatus::MISSING_OR_UNKNOWN;
}
return HopStartStatus::VALID;
}
